Fractures around Trochanteric Nails: The “Vergilius Classification System”

Table 3

Published peri-implant femoral fracture classifications.

AuthorsJournalYear of publicationProsLimitationMain differences with the present classification

Skela-Rosenbaum et al.Injury2016Treatment-oriented classification; classification included only PNFs; evaluated fracture occurred around a single type of nailNot validated; did not consider the original fracture healing status; classified fracture occurred only around short nailsOriginal EF healing status considered; classification of fracture occurred around long nails; comprehensive morphological classification; evaluation of fracture fragmentation
Chan et al.Arch Orthop Trauma Surg2017Treatment-oriented; evaluated the original EF healing stateIncluded also fractures occurred around plates; did not include fracture occurred in the proximal part of the nail; did not consider fracture fragmentation and morphologyComprehensive morphological and anatomical classification; classification of fracture occurred only around TN; evaluation of fracture fragmentation
Videla-Cés et al.Injury2018Large cohort, comprehensive anatomical and morphological classificationNot treatment-oriented; included also fractures around plates; not validated; did not consider the original fracture healing status; did not consider fracture fragmentationOriginal EF healing status considered; fracture fragmentation considered; classification of fracture occurred only around TN
